If youre looking for sexy shots of Ashley Alexandra Dupré, the young escort behind the political demise of former New York governor Eliot Spitzer, see Client 9: The Rise and Fall of Eliot Spitzer. The documentary has the same lascivious images of her that were splattered all over the media when the news of the scandal broke in early 2008. Client 9, however, screening today at 14 Pews, goes far beyond the sex angle to expose an entire city that indulged in a culture of excess just before the economic crash of 2008. While he stops short of absolving Spitzer (and even gets him to offer some contrite apologies on camera), director Alex Gibney positions the ex-gov as a crusader against corrupt and greedy Wall Street bankers. Did Spitzer choose his own demise? Yes. But what was and still is happening inside the financial industry is just as icky. 4 p.m. Saturday, 7 p.m. Sunday. 800 Aurora.
